Why Solar?
Installing solar panels on your home offers numerous advantages, from financial savings to environmental benefits. Here’s why you should consider switching to solar energy:
Solar panels can significantly reduce your electricity bills. Many regions offer incentives and rebates that help offset installation costs and make solar energy an affordable investment with substantial long-term savings.
By generating your own electricity, you become less reliant on the grid. This is especially beneficial during power outages or in remote areas with limited grid access. Solar power provides a reliable and continuous energy source.
Homes with solar panels often see increased property values. Buyers recognize the long-term savings and environmental benefits, making solar-equipped homes more attractive in the real estate market.
Solar energy is a clean, renewable source that reduces your carbon footprint. Unlike fossil fuels, it doesn't emit greenhouse gases, contributing to a healthier planet and combating climate change.

Homeowners in Benjamin, Utah, face a growing challenge: insurance companies threatening to cancel policies over aging or storm-damaged roofs. With Benjamin’s rural setting and exposure to Utah’s harsh weather—think heavy snow, high winds, and occasional hail—roofs here wear out faster than in less extreme climates. When insurers flag a roof as a risk, they often demand a replacement, leaving homeowners with a costly dilemma. A new roof can run $15,000 to $25,000, and most Benjamin families don’t have that kind of cash on hand. Traditional roofing companies offer financing, but their rates—like 12.99% over 10 years—lead to steep payments that can overwhelm budgets.
For insurance agents in Benjamin, this creates a ripple effect. Clients facing policy cancellations may look for new agents who can offer solutions, putting your business at risk. At Ask Solar Mike, we’ve developed a groundbreaking program that helps insurance agents protect their clients’ policies while saving homeowners money. By bundling roof replacements with solar installations, we offer a cost-effective alternative that also combats predatory roofing practices plaguing Utah.
Benjamin’s location in Utah County means homes are exposed to intense weather patterns that accelerate roof deterioration. Cracked shingles, leaks, and wind damage are common, and insurance companies are quick to act. If a roof fails inspection, homeowners must replace it or lose coverage—a tough choice when the cost of a new roof is so high. Traditional financing options from roofing companies often come with high interest rates, making a $20,000 roof cost around $350 per month over 10 years at 12.99%.
Worse, predatory roofing companies exploit these situations, inflating insurance claims or delivering subpar work that drives up premiums and erodes trust. Insurance agents are left in a difficult position, watching clients struggle and worrying about losing their business to competitors who can offer better solutions.
Our solar-plus-roofing program is designed to help Benjamin homeowners—and their insurance agents—overcome these challenges. Here’s how it works:
30% Roofing Discount: When a roof replacement is bundled with a solar installation, homeowners save 30% on the roof cost. A $20,000 roof drops to $14,000.
Affordable Financing: We offer 6.99% financing over 20 years with no money down, reducing monthly payments to about $150 for a $14,000 roof—less than half the cost of traditional roofing loans.
Energy Bill Savings: Solar panels offset electricity costs, often saving $50–$100 per month, making the project even more budget-friendly.
Protection from Scams: Our transparent process ensures quality work without inflated claims, shielding homeowners from predatory roofing companies.
This means it’s more affordable for Benjamin homeowners to get a new roof and solar system together than to replace their roof alone. Plus, our Class 3 and Class 4 impact-resistant shingles often qualify for insurance discounts, further reducing premiums.

Whether you need a battery for your solar system depends on your energy goals and needs. Batteries can store excess energy generated by your solar panels, providing power during the night or during grid outages. If you live in an area with frequent power outages or want to maximize your energy independence, a battery could be a valuable addition.
The duration of a solar installation can vary depending on various factors, including the size of the system, complexity of the installation, and local permitting processes. Typically, a residential solar installation takes anywhere from one to two days to complete once all necessary permits are obtained. Local city and utility permits can take a few weeks. The number of solar panels you need depends on several factors, including your energy consumption, available roof space, and the efficiency of the panels. A typical household in the United States may require anywhere from 20 to 30 solar panels to meet its energy needs. To determine the exact number for your home, we will conduct a thorough assessment, taking into account your energy usage patterns and the specific characteristics of your property. By analyzing your electricity bills and evaluating your roof's orientation and shading, we can recommend the optimal number of panels to maximize energy production and savings.
